  • Do remember that the T500 boiler top can't take much weight... That's with the 2" StillDragon adapter to tri-clamp. Make a 3" hole and heavier column and the situation got worse. Unless you replace the top completely that is.

  • thanks @squeakyclean , I was going to use the adapter to tri-clamp then a 3" to 2" reducer onto which the rest of the 3" bits go, I will use pipe hangers if need be to support the weight. What do you think of the power of the boiler? enough to charge the plates etc?

  • Your output rate is limited to your input power. You are not going to get the full benefit of the extra diameter. Yes you can activate the plates and you'll likely never need a reflux condenser due to all the passive reflux.
